Output 30c076314e63d80b047ae538b181a242b11538e6f8de2a77bcaee53d9c52eebc:7

value
37153
script pubkey
OP_0 OP_PUSHBYTES_20 b57504bf026e0fa0295d2c18e95bbd545d65244d
address
bc1qk46sf0czdc86q22a9svwjkaa23wk2fzdkxvfal
transaction
30c076314e63d80b047ae538b181a242b11538e6f8de2a77bcaee53d9c52eebc
confirmations
3129
spent
true